Zanesville-Muskingum County (Ohio) Port Authority

Acronym: ZMCPA - Formal name: Zanesville-Muskingum County Port Authority

Information

Organization's Own Description:

The Zanesville-Muskingum County Port Authority (ZMCPA) was created in 1987 by Muskingum County and the City of Zanesville as the economic development agent of both the city and county. The ZMCPA is a governmental entity with business-like powers useful for promoting economic development. Since 1987, the ZMCPA has played a critical role in the development of the NorthPointe Business Park, the Airport Business Park, and the EastPointe Business Park. Since its inception, the ZMCPA has fostered and supported the location, development and growth of numerous companies who have created thousands of jobs in our community.
